GridBank: A Grid Accounting Services Architecture (GASA) for Distributed Systems Sharing and Integration

Alexander Barmouta Rajkumar Buyya
DOI: https://doi.org/10.48550/arXiv.cs/0210002
2002-10-01
Abstract:Computational Grids are emerging as new infrastructure for Internet-based parallel and distributed computing. They enable the sharing, exchange, discovery, and aggregation of resources distributed across multiple administrative domains, organizations and enterprises. To accomplish this, Grids need infrastructure that supports various services: security, uniform access, resource management, scheduling, application composition, computational economy, and accountability. Many Grid projects have developed technologies that provide many of these services with an exception of accountability. To overcome this limitation, we propose a new infrastructure called Grid Bank that provides services for accounting. This paper presents requirements of Grid accountability and different models within which it can operate and proposes Grid Bank Services Architecture that meets them. The paper highlights implementation issues with detailed discussion on format for various records/database that the GridBank need to maintain. It also presents protocols for interaction between GridBank and various components within Grid computing environments.
Distributed, Parallel, and Cluster Computing
What problem does this paper attempt to address?